    This storyline faux pas has probably pissed me off more than any other.

    Jamie's story throughout this series has been one of the more inspiring and interesting stories of the bunch.

    You start the show thinking that the guy is this self-centered egomaniac who hates everyone for any reason. He effs his own sister and he pushes an innocent little boy out of a tower. He was a reviled prick.

    Then over time, he's humbled, he shows depth, humor, insight to his past and what made him a hateful jerk, shows love for his brother when the other family members despised Tyrion... Basically Jamie travels the ultimate road of redemption and becomes a fan favorite.

    He mends fences, rights his wrongs and does everything that a "good person" should do.... THEN he leaves all of that behind to go back to Cersei, the woman who played a part in why he was such a prick!?!?! She wanted him killed. Bronn told him that she hired him to kill Jamie. Now Jaime is going back to her!?!?!

    Like I said, I can forgive a lot of the story related debacles that have unfolded with this season, but that one, I cannot. I cringed when he told Brienne that he was a hateful person.

    No bitch! You've been awesome since Season 4, don't f*ck it up now that you're at the 1 yard line (I'm saying that to the writers, not Jaime.... cuz Jaime is a fictional person.... duh! lol)

    The Glamour story was fun, but those weren't past evidences of madness. The were evidence of Dany's dragon blood.

    When we first meet Daenerys way back in season one, she's under the thumb of her brother, Viserys, who forces her to marry Khal Drogo. But as the Khaleesi, she begins to find her voice and her power. When Khal eventually kills Viserys (with a "crown" of molten gold), Dany is eerily calm as she says, "He is not a dragon. Fire cannot kill a dragon."


    That's not a foreshadowing of madness. She is stating a fact. He was killed by a fire because he was not a dragon. Daenerys, on the other hand, walks into a fire with stone eggs and comes out with baby dragons. The fire doesn't kill her because she is a human dragon.

    In season six the Khaleesi is once again reunited with the Dothraki, but on less than friendly terms. Eventually the army bends to her will, but only after she burns all the Khals in their hut and emerges from the fire unscathed.

    Again, not a sign of madness. She can emerge from the fire unscathed because she has dragon blood in her veins.

    She burns KL because she is furious and she is a dragon.

    If she is going to be murdered, they better try something other than fire.
